Output 34a8a73a30bcf04f613c210c7065c9052be3bbb4fb33f7c944ada2511a17aedf:9

value
12632
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f8b289d165669d3118c6fec482a77e6c99ca250 OP_EQUAL
address
3DKQSpRjqGiiBXc3sX9mSuAbU4g25huPrZ
transaction
34a8a73a30bcf04f613c210c7065c9052be3bbb4fb33f7c944ada2511a17aedf
spent
true